Bug description:
Binary package hint: gwibber
My identi.ca account is activated using Launchpad as the OpenID
provider. However when setting up an account in Gwibber it cannot
authenticate against the account. The only workaround is generating a
password in Identi.ca and using this which is fairly suboptimal as the
aim for OpenID is precisely avoiding this account sprawling.
